BIO PALEMBANICABIO PALEMBANICAIndonesia hosts a remarkable diversity of freshwater fishes, including numerous endemic wild Betta Betta spp. (Anabantiformes: Osphronemidae). However, the rise of e-commerce has facilitated unregulated online trade of wild Betta species. This study investigates the diversity, conservation status, and trade dynamics of wild Betta species between 1–21 October 2025, in Indonesias three largest online marketplaces: Shopee, Tokopedia, and Lazada. A total of 38 wild Betta species were identified, including five Critically Endangered, eleven Endangered, and seven Vulnerable taxa. The trade was dominated by species from Sumatra and Kalimantan, which together accounted for over 85% of endemic taxa. Market analysis revealed a positive correlation between rarity and price, with Endangered and Not Assessed species commanding the highest average prices. The presence of Critically Endangered species such as Betta chloropharynx and B. hendra indicates ongoing extraction from the wild despite conservation risks. Furthermore, nearly 26% of traded species remain Data Deficient or Not Assessed, reflecting critical knowledge gaps that hinder management and policy enforcement. The findings underscore the urgent need for stronger regulation of digital wildlife trade, improved conservation assessments, and promotion of captive breeding programs to reduce wild collection pressure.

Further research should investigate the motivations of consumers purchasing wild Betta online, exploring factors like aesthetic preferences and perceived rarity, to inform targeted conservation campaigns. Additionally, a comprehensive genetic analysis of wild-caught and captive-bred Betta populations is needed to assess the impact of trade on genetic diversity and identify potential risks of inbreeding depression. Finally, studies should focus on developing and implementing effective traceability systems for Betta species traded online, utilizing technologies like DNA barcoding or blockchain to verify the origin and legality of specimens, thereby enhancing transparency and accountability within the ornamental fish trade. These investigations, combined with strengthened law enforcement and community engagement, are crucial for ensuring the long-term sustainability of wild Betta populations in Indonesia and preventing further biodiversity loss.
